A fan-made, NOT FOR PROFIT sequel to the critically acclaimed shooter "Spec Ops: The Line".

In the aftermath of his psychological breakdown as a result of his journey through the hellish landscape of a post-apocalyptic Dubai, Captain Martin Walker slaughters the contingent of American soldiers sent to rescue him and retreats back into the city. Six months later, Walker has declared himself the de facto ruler of the city and has dedicated himself to the survival of it's remaining citizens, at any cost.

Meanwhile, a team of Tier One Operators, led by Special Warfare Operator Virgil McNally, is covertly sent in to Dubai to find Walker and bring him in for court martial, to answer for his crimes. Little do they know the horrors that the ruined city and Capt. Walker have waiting for them.

Spec Ops: The Road Back will be a cover-based, Third-Person shooter with tactical gameplay, ideally built using Unreal Engine 4.
